US Demand for Titanium Mineral Concentrates to Reach 1.2 Million Metric Tons in 2022

by Corinne Gangloff

March 6, 2018

Cleveland, OH, March 6, 2018 — US demand for titanium mineral concentrates is forecast to reach 1.2 million metric tons in 2022, according to Titanium: United States, a report recently released by Freedonia Focus Reports. Growing production of paint and plastic, supported by increasing building construction activity, will stimulate US titanium dioxide (TiO2) pigment production and consumption of the required concentrates. Rising TiO2 pigment production is forecast to account for the majority of gains in demand for titanium concentrates.

US demand for titanium metal in volume terms is forecast grow 3.8% annually through 2022. Suppliers of titanium metal benefit from a lack of comparable substitutes for the material. Aerospace represents the largest application segment for titanium metal. Suppliers will benefit from rising production of aerospace equipment, primarily aircraft, as well as from the higher proportions of titanium consumed by aircraft manufacturers.

These and other key insights are featured in Titanium: United States. This report forecasts to 2022 US demand for titanium mineral concentrates, TiO2 pigments, and titanium metal in metric tons and nominal US dollars at the manufacturer level. Total demand for titanium mineral concentrates in metric tons represents TiO2 content and is segmented by application in terms of:

  • TiO2 pigments
  • other applications

Demand for TiO2 pigment in metric tons is segmented by application as follows:

  • paint
  • plastic
  • paper
  • other applications

Demand for titanium metal in metric tons – including both metal sponge and scrap – is segmented by application as follows:

  • aerospace
  • industrial and other applications

To illustrate historical trends, total demand for titanium mineral concentrates, TiO2 pigment, and titanium metal in volume and value terms, and the various segments in volume terms are provided in annual series from 2007 to 2017.
